Looks like the OSD team blog is alive again, has been quiet for some time,
Keep an eye on it here: http://blogs.technet.com/inside_osd/
RSS to it here: http://blogs.technet.com/inside_osd/rss.xml
Read the complete post at http://wmug.co.uk/blogs/r0b/archive/2010/05/13/operating-system-deployment-team-blog-lights-are-back-on.aspx